Conklin sidelined ~2 weeks with spring calf injury; cautious approach.
Tyler ConklinTEDET
Conklin suffered a calf injury in the spring and will miss approximately two weeks to start camp. Coach Dan Campbell stated: 'Conklin is probably going to be about two weeks here. Somewhere in there. He's running. He got a little calf (injury) back in the spring. We're hopeful. No setback. We're trying to be smart with him, but hopefully get him back as soon as possible so we can get some reps on him.' The Lions are being cautious with his recovery.
